Weeding and mulching services are designed to maintain healthy and attractive landscape beds by removing unwanted plants and applying protective ground covers. The process typically involves carefully extracting weeds, including invasive species and persistent grasses, to prevent them from competing with desirable plants. Mulching involves spreading a layer of organic or inorganic material over soil surfaces to suppress weed growth, conserve moisture, and improve the overall appearance of garden beds. These services help create a more manageable and aesthetically pleasing outdoor space, reducing the need for ongoing manual weed removal.

These services address common landscaping challenges such as weed overgrowth, soil erosion, and uneven plant growth. Weeds can quickly take over garden beds, choking out flowers, shrubs, and other desirable plants, which can lead to increased maintenance efforts and reduced plant health. Mulching helps mitigate these issues by providing a barrier that inhibits weed germination and growth while also helping to regulate soil temperature and moisture levels. Proper weed control and mulching contribute to healthier plant development and a more uniform, tidy landscape.

The overview below groups typical Weeding And Mulching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aiken,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Weeding Services - The cost for weeding typically ranges from $50 to $150 per hour, depending on the size of the area and weed density. For a small garden, prices might be closer to $50, while larger landscapes can reach $150 or more.

Mulching Services - Mulching costs generally fall between $100 and $300 per cubic yard, with prices varying based on mulch type and delivery distance. Installing mulch in a standard 500-square-foot garden often costs around $150 to $250.

Combined Weeding and Mulching - When services are combined, the total cost often ranges from $200 to $600, influenced by the property's size and the scope of work. Local pros may provide package rates for both services in a single visit.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ary depending on the complexity of the landscape and regional pricing differences. It's common for prices to fluctuate based on specific project requirements and local service provider rates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of regular weeding and mulching? Regular weeding and mulching help maintain garden health by reducing weed growth, conserving soil moisture, and improving soil fertility, leading to a more attractive landscape.

How often should mulching be reapplied? The frequency of reapplication depends on the type of mulch used and local conditions, but typically mulching is refreshed every one to two years to maintain its effectiveness.

What types of mulch are available for landscaping? Common mulch options include organic materials like wood chips, bark, straw, and compost, as well as inorganic options such as gravel and rubber mulch.

Can professional services help with weed removal and mulch installation? Yes, local landscaping professionals offer weed removal and mulch installation services to help keep landscapes tidy and healthy.

What should be considered when choosing mulch for a garden? Factors to consider include the type of plants, desired appearance, durability, and maintenance needs to select the most suitable mulch for a landscape.
